When discussing battery configurations, it is crucial to understand how they affect voltage and capacity. In a series configuration, batteries are connected end-to-end, increasing the total voltage while maintaining the same capacity. For instance, if two 3.7V batteries are connected in series, the total voltage becomes 7.4V. This setup is typically preferred by users who desire higher voltage outputs for more powerful devices. However, it is important to note that if one battery fails, the entire system is compromised, which can lead to serious safety issues.
On the other hand, a parallel configuration involves connecting batteries alongside each other, maintaining the same voltage while increasing the total capacity. For example, two 3.7V batteries in parallel will still output 3.7V, but the capacity (measured in milliampere-hours, or mAh) doubles. This configuration is often favored by vapers who prioritize extended battery life and lower voltage devices. In terms of safety, parallel setups can be more forgiving; if one battery fails, the others can often continue to function normally, reducing the risk of catastrophic failure.
